I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S

ikWARNING

To reduce the risk of fire, eiectricai shock, or

injury when using your refrigerator, foiiow these
basic precautions:

• Read ail instructions before using the

refrigerator.

• Child entrapment and suffocation are

not problems of the past. Junked or

abandoned refrigerators are stiil danger­
ous ... even if they wiii “just sit in the
garage a few days.”

If you are getting rid of your old

refrigerator, do it safely. Please read the

enclosed safety booklet from the
Association of Home Appliance Manu­
facturers. Help prevent accidents.

• Never allow children to operate, play with,

or crawl inside the refrigerator.

• Never clean refrigerator parts with flam­

mable fluids. The fumes can create a fire
hazard or explosion.

• FOR YOUR SAFETY •

DO NOT STORE OR USE GASOLINE OR
OTHER FLAMMABLE VAPORS AND
LIQUIDS IN THE VICINITY OF THIS OR

ANY OTHER APPLIANCE. THE FUMES

CAN CREATE A FIRE HAZARD OR EX­
PLOSION.

Help us help you

Please:

• Install and level the refrigerator on a floor

that will hold the weight and in an area
suitable for its size and use.

• Do not install the refrigerator near an oven,

radiator, or other heat source.

• Do not use the refrigerator in an area

where the room temperature will fall below
55°F (13°C).

• Keep the refrigerator out of the weather.
• Connect the refrigerator only to the proper

kind of outlet, with the correct electrical
supply and grounding. (Refer to the
Electrical Requirements and Grounding

Instructions Sheet.)

• Do not load the refrigerator with food

before it has time to get properly cold.

• Use the refrigerator only for the uses

described in this manual.

• Properly maintain the refrigerator.
• Be sure the refrigerator is not used by

anyone unable to operate it properly.
